Don't take this the wrong way: Your cat is not impressed by your yoga skills (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=V3Y8IU6st5E).
That's not to say your headstand is unimpressive. We who lack the core strength and balance to execute and hold that yoga pose (not to mention, most others) are downright wowed by your skill. We can barely touch our toes without groaning in pain. Kudos to you for being so fit.
But don't think for a second that your cat gives one iota of a darn about all of that. Look at him: He steps right in front of the camera, then pretty much goes to sleep. It's like getting served a steaming hot plate of kibble-flavored humble pie.
Cats -- they're just jerks (http://start.westnet.ca/newstempch.php?article=2014/09/08/cats-bullying-people-compilation_n_5786790.html).
